Disadvantages and Advantages of using Smatphones

                                             SMARTPHONES 

 
 A smartphone, is a cellular phone that performs many of the functions of a computer, typically having a touchscreen interface, Internet access, and an operating system capable of running downloaded applications.

ADVANTAGES; 

 Smartphone's are one of the most popular forms of communication all over the world, they have many advantages; first of all they are multi functional, in addition they are quick to communicate with, and finally they make it very easy to stay in touch. They are Multi functional because they are phones and ambulant personal computers. Also they are quick because you can communicate in seconds with everybody, and also you can send important information and documents in seconds in any place… They make it very easy to stay in touch because you can write to friends easily and start a communication with them at any moment.
